PSEO - Post Secondary Education Option
PSEO (Post Secondary Enrollment Option) is an opportunity that allows high school sophomores, juniors and seniors to take college-level courses and earn both high school and college credit.
The PSEO program, funded through the Minnesota Department of Education, covers the high school student's tuition and cost of textbooks for college-level courses (numbered 1000 level or higher).

Reciprocity allows a student to attend a college outside of their home state for a reduced tuition rate.
Currently, Minnesota has an interstate reciprocity agreement with Wisconsin, North Dakota, South Dakota and the province of Manitoba. This allows students to obtain tuition rates for schools outside their home state at a comparable in-state price.
A secondary reciprocity program exists between the majority of the Midwestern schools. This program is known as the Midwestern Student Exchange Program (MSEP). This program allows students to attend participating schools in these states at a lower tuition rate than the standard out of state tuition price. For additional information and to apply for reciprocity for an MSEP school see the link below. **Minnesota residents interested in a Wisconsin or Dakota school must apply for tuition reciprocity rather than the Midwest Student Exchange Program.**
